Katmo PRODUCT NAME
Vaccinium whitfordii Merr. SCIENTIFIC NAME
| Common Name: | Katmo |
| Local Name: | Fafalong (Bontoc); Katmo (Benguet); Lusong (Lepanto); Parukapol (Nueva Ecija) |
| Family: | Ericaceae |
| Other Species of Same Genera: | |
| Product Description: | A shrub or small tree 1-5m in height or taller. The leaves are about 1.5cm in length and 5mm wide. The flowers are small and red. The fruits are produced singly in the axils of the leaves. They are small, black, juicy, subacid, sweet, and of good quality |
| NTFP Classification: | Food and food ingredients (plant-derived) |
DISTRIBUTION
| Countries Found: | Philippines |
| Description: | This species is found in the northern part of Luzon, particularly in the Mountain Province, and also in Mindoro, Leyte, and Negros occidental. It is not cultivated |
USES AND PARTS USED
| Parts Used: | fruits |
| Uses: | The fruit is edible |
